Home Assistant with socat for remote zwave

Based on homeassistant/home-assistant image, published on docker hub. Please report issues on github. Instead of using a locally-connected zwave device (usb stick/etc), we can use a serial device mapped over the network with ser2net and then map it to a local zwave serial device with socat. This docker container ensures that

  • a zwave device is mapped in the local docker with socat
  • home assistant is running If there are any failures, both socat and home assistant will be restarted.

Environment options:

All homeassistant-home-assistant image options are available and on top of that a few others have been added:

DEBUG_VERBOSE=0 (Set to 1 to see more information; Default: 0)

PAUSE_BETWEEN_CHECKS=2 (In seconds, how much time to wait between checking running processes; Default: 2)

LOG_TARGET=/log.log (Path to log file. Ommit to write logs to stdout; Default: stdout)

SOCAT_ZWAVE_TYPE="tcp"

SOCAT_ZWAVE_HOST="192.168.5.5"

SOCAT_ZWAVE_PORT="7676" (Where socat should connect to - will be used as tcp://192.168.5.5:7676)

SOCAT_ZWAVE_LINK="/dev/zwave" (What the zwave device should be mapped to. Use this in your home assistant configuration file.)
